Abstract

The invention discloses a diameter variable PDC directional drill bit. The diameter variable PDC directional drill bit is provided with a drill bit body; a diameter variable cutting component is at least arranged in the radial direction of the drill bit body; the cutting diameter of the drill bit body is changed through linear displacement of the diameter variable cutting component; a gear-rack transmission mechanism is in linkage with the diameter variable cutting component and is embedded into the drill bit body; an elastomer is arranged on the gear-rack transmission mechanism in a sleevingmanner; and a fixed cutting component is also arranged in the radial direction of the drill bit body. After drilling is completed, the size of the outside diameter of the diameter variable PDC directional drill bit disclosed by the invention is reduced, so that the sizes of the outside diameters of a wire measuring drill pipe, a non-magnetic rod, a screw motor and the drill bit connected from a hole orifice are consistent; the problem of jamming of the drill bit caused by drilling hole shrinkage is effectively solved; and the safety of drilling is ensured. The transfer from axial movement to radial movement is realized by adopting the gear-rack transmission mechanism; the structure is stable and reliable; the bearing capacity is high; the transmission precision is high; and the size of thedrill bit can be controlled precisely.

Description

technical field [0001] The invention relates to a drill bit for underground drilling in coal mines, in particular to a variable-diameter PDC directional drill bit. Background technique [0002] With the development of underground directional drilling technology in coal mines, it has been widely used in drilling fields such as gas drainage, grouting reinforcement, and water exploration. The strata encountered in underground coal mines include both coal seams and complex and changeable rock formations. When drilling into loose, broken, and easily collapsed rock formations or coal seams, the diameter of the borehole is likely to become smaller after the hole is formed, that is, the phenomenon of diameter shrinkage. A stuck drill accident occurred.
